A set of unit-testing patterns for DUnitX, a Delphi testing framework. Unit tests check small parts of a program, while integration tests check how parts such as an application and database work together.

In plain words
What is it for?
Use it to create test fixtures, test services and entities, mock repositories, run database integration tests, or practise TDD, which means writing tests before the code.
Why use it?
It provides a consistent way to organise tests and replace real dependencies with test substitutes, making changes and refactoring safer.

DUnitX Testing Patterns — Skill

Use this skill when creating or organizing unit tests in Delphi projects.

When to Use

  • When creating tests for new features
  • When applying TDD (Test-Driven Development)
  • When creating database integration tests
  • When refactoring existing tests

Test Project Structure

tests/
├── MeuApp.Tests.dpr                 ← Projeto de testes
├── Domain/
│   ├── MeuApp.Tests.Customer.Entity.pas
│   └── MeuApp.Tests.Order.Entity.pas
├── Application/
│   ├── MeuApp.Tests.Customer.Service.pas
│   └── MeuApp.Tests.Order.Service.pas
├── Infrastructure/
│   └── MeuApp.Tests.Customer.Repository.pas
└── Helpers/
    ├── MeuApp.Tests.Helpers.Database.pas
    └── MeuApp.Tests.Helpers.Mocks.pas

Basic Test Fixture

unit MeuApp.Tests.Customer.Service;

interface

uses
  DUnitX.TestFramework,
  MeuApp.Domain.Customer.Entity,
  MeuApp.Domain.Customer.Repository.Intf,
  MeuApp.Application.Customer.Service;

type
  [TestFixture]
  TCustomerServiceTest = class
  private
    FService: TCustomerService;
    FMockRepo: ICustomerRepository;
  public
    [Setup]
    procedure Setup;

    [TearDown]
    procedure TearDown;

    [Test]
    procedure CreateCustomer_WithValidData_ShouldSucceed;

    [Test]
    procedure CreateCustomer_WithEmptyName_ShouldRaiseException;

    [Test]
    procedure CreateCustomer_WithDuplicateCpf_ShouldRaiseException;

    [Test]
    procedure GetById_WithExistingId_ShouldReturnCustomer;

    [Test]
    procedure GetById_WithInvalidId_ShouldRaiseNotFoundException;
  end;

implementation

uses
  System.SysUtils;

{ TCustomerServiceTest }

procedure TCustomerServiceTest.Setup;
begin
  FMockRepo := TMemoryCustomerRepository.Create;
  FService := TCustomerService.Create(FMockRepo);
end;

procedure TCustomerServiceTest.TearDown;
begin
  FService.Free;
  //FMockRepo is interface — released automatically
end;

[Test]
procedure TCustomerServiceTest.CreateCustomer_WithValidData_ShouldSucceed;
begin
  Assert.WillNotRaiseAny(
    procedure
    begin
      FService.CreateCustomer('João Silva', '12345678901', '[email protected]');
    end
  );
end;

[Test]
procedure TCustomerServiceTest.CreateCustomer_WithEmptyName_ShouldRaiseException;
begin
  Assert.WillRaise(
    procedure
    begin
      FService.CreateCustomer('', '12345678901', '[email protected]');
    end,
    EValidationException
  );
end;

[Test]
procedure TCustomerServiceTest.CreateCustomer_WithDuplicateCpf_ShouldRaiseException;
begin
  FService.CreateCustomer('João', '12345678901', '[email protected]');

  Assert.WillRaise(
    procedure
    begin
      FService.CreateCustomer('Maria', '12345678901', '[email protected]');
    end,
    EBusinessRuleException
  );
end;

[Test]
procedure TCustomerServiceTest.GetById_WithExistingId_ShouldReturnCustomer;
var
  LCustomer: TCustomer;
begin
  FService.CreateCustomer('João', '12345678901', '[email protected]');

  LCustomer := FService.GetById(1);
  try
    Assert.IsNotNull(LCustomer);
    Assert.AreEqual('João', LCustomer.Name);
  finally
    LCustomer.Free;
  end;
end;

[Test]
procedure TCustomerServiceTest.GetById_WithInvalidId_ShouldRaiseNotFoundException;
begin
  Assert.WillRaise(
    procedure
    begin
      FService.GetById(999);
    end,
    EEntityNotFoundException
  );
end;

initialization
  TDUnitX.RegisterTestFixture(TCustomerServiceTest);

end.
